When I was at the show I ended up changing my decision from a Fox Wing to a new product on the market called a Supa-Wing made by a Queensland company, Supa-Peg at Yatala. I changed my decision purely on the fact of a couple of things, one that it's made from canvas and is dynaproofed so i hope it lasts longer,that is a local made product with a 2yr warranty, slightly different shape than the FW, not as neatly packed up as the FW but we'll see how it goes. Also I had to do a few mods to the brackets so it would fit my rhino roof rack with the alloy tray where as the FW would bolt straight on. So if you wish to see it look at Supa-Wing on the net and it has a couple of You Tube video's of it.

Bolting on the foxwing
I've got a RHS foxwing as the left side of the vehicle has a fold out, pole-less awning which the foxwing will wrap around to line up with. Both awnings will both be fitted to a roof cage from roofcage.com.
The foxwing mounting channels are 100mm apart, running the whole 2500mm length of the foxwing. The awning comes with four T-Bolts/Square head bolts that normally bolt into the roof bar plastic attachment mounts. The bolts are a b*tch to source, but creative googling found Battery Bolts to be the quickest and cheapest way of getting more which are a few cm longer. The foxwing T Bolts are M8 x 25mm long, with a 13mm square head, 5mm thick. Sourcing some which are longer lets me bolt it into plates etc and put in anti-theft locks.
I wanted to over-engineer the mounting so I've ordered 20 bolts (I need 12) and will quad bolt the foxwing in three places along its length to vertical plates on the roof cage. Here's the pic, viewed from the RHS of the vehicle looking at the roof cage:

Originally posted by amr75wcr View PostHi Loza we have had one for about 18 months. They are easy set up and the coverage is great (just be careful in windy conditions, i was setting ours up a couple of months bach at Double Island point and a slight gust of wind came just after i hooked the strap and the foxwing ended up about 5 meters in the air until the pivot points snapped. Fortunatly Rhino replaced the broken parts under warranty). we have added some LED strip lights from trusty ebay takes the awaning to a whole new level at night.
